Linguistic Origin & Historical Etymology
Originating in the mid-17th century at the University of Cambridge, the word likely derives from the Greek word chronios, meaning 'long-lasting' or 'permanent'. Initially university slang for a long-time chum or intimate companion, its connotation shifted over time to frequently imply a close friend or companion of a powerful person, often in a derogatory context involving favoritism.

View all stories →How Are Palisade Cells Adapted for Photosynthesis (and Why Are They Called 'Palisade')?
Palisade mesophyll cells are column-shaped, densely packed with chloroplasts, and positioned near the leaf's upper surface to maximize light absorption for photosynthesis. Their name comes from the French word for a defensive fence of wooden stakes, referencing their tightly aligned, upright cellular structure.
